In a thrilling display of rugby prowess, Wales emerged victorious against Italy in the Six Nations 2026, ending a three-year losing streak and igniting a wave of emotion and relief among the home team and their supporters. This match, a pivotal moment in Welsh rugby history, showcased the team's resilience and determination to break free from a prolonged period of disappointment.
The significance of this victory cannot be overstated. Wales had endured a challenging run, conceding a substantial number of points in their opening losses, but the narrow defeats against Scotland and Ireland hinted at a turning point. And indeed, the win against Italy marked that turning point, a long-awaited step forward in their journey.

A Tale of Two Halves
The first half belonged to Wales, with their rampant attack and effective line-out play. The second half, however, saw Italy make a comeback, with a try from replacement hooker Di Bartolomeo. This period of the game showcased the resilience of both teams, with Wales' defense stepping up to deny Italy further scores.
